Unyielding Foundations: Exploring Bon Jovi's 'This House Is Not For Sale'

Bon Jovi's 'This House Is Not For Sale' serves as a powerful metaphor for personal integrity and resilience in the face of adversity. The song uses the imagery of a house to represent the self or soul, emphasizing the strength and permanence of personal values and memories. The repeated line, 'This house is not for sale,' symbolizes the singer's unwavering commitment to his core beliefs and identity, despite external pressures or challenges.

The lyrics describe the house as enduring various hardships, such as 'the door is off the hinges' and 'the streets are on fire.' These images convey a sense of turmoil and destruction, suggesting that the external world is fraught with difficulties that threaten to invade or undermine the sanctity of the 'house.' However, the steadfast declaration that the house is not for sale reaffirms a refusal to give in or compromise one's foundational principles.

Bon Jovi further deepens this theme by noting the personal effort and care invested in building this metaphorical house: 'I set each stone and I hammered each nail.' This line highlights the deliberate and painstaking efforts to create a life of substance and meaning. The song is not just about resistance but also about the pride and satisfaction derived from building something truly significant and maintaining it against all odds. The house, built on trust and set on higher ground, symbolizes a life elevated by steadfast values and unshakeable trust.
